How much does it cost to rent a home in Osprey?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Osprey 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,384 | $1,750 | $10,000+ |
Osprey 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,907 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
Osprey 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,907 | $2,900 | $10,000+ |
Osprey 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,133 | $3,900 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Osprey
What type of rentals are currently available in Osprey?
There are currently 43 Apartments for Rent in Osprey,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,100 to $3,880. There are also 204 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Osprey ranging from $1,595 to $37,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Osprey?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Osprey ranges from $1,595 to $37,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,904.
